Nordic business values and opportunities will be discussed at EHU

Young Lithuanian entrepreneur Dovydas Duoblys, recognized as one of the most successful young business leaders in Northern Europe, will be featured next month in an EHU Public Conversation. It will take place December 1 at 12:00 p.m. at Novotel Vilnius Centre.

Dovydas Duoblys is a partner at Solid Supply—a Lithuanian company that provides furniture based décor solutions for retail stores and shops. His company generates €4 million in turnover with a stable yearly growth rate of 40%. The company’s business model is to move away from mass production to custom-made products. Exporting 70% of its products, the company has a strong Nordic orientation both in terms of market and business culture.

Nordic Business Report includes Duoblys on its list of Greatest Young Leaders under the Age of 30 in Northern Europe together with other entrepreneurs from the region. The criteria for evaluating possible candidates were: results achieved, business sense, originality, practicality and impact of their ideas, international outlook, and responsibility in their actions.

Duoblys’s talk will focus on his experience in starting a company with Nordic values and the current business environment in Lithuania and the Nordics. He will also share what he learned on his way to success. The talk will be moderated by Dr. Darius Udrys, EHU Vice-Rector for Development and Communications.
